Grammy Award for Best R&B Album
The Grammy Award for Best R&B; Album has been awarded since 1995. The award was split into two categories in 2003: Best Contemporary R&B; Album is for R&B; LPs that have modern hip-hop stylings to them, while Best R&B; Album is for R&B; LPs that are more traditional and less electronic. Years...
